Transaction 83bb92205fc661f2bccfd4fe9760d1f7c3c9cdc5ecfd3f23504cc8ab536571aa
1 Input
1 Output
-
83bb92205fc661f2bccfd4fe9760d1f7c3c9cdc5ecfd3f23504cc8ab536571aa:0
- value
- 18000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5619325eabc1209b24880416cf4e5dfb958c5479 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18rFJCXj4kXz5PGrzhf7Yyb7NkKj74Cvb9